Rolls Royce Ghost blinged up by Mansory into an electric blue Ghost


Lovers of the classic, silver Rolls Royce were shocked to death (and so were we) when they spotted this garish, electric blue version of the Ghost customized by Swiss company Mansory at Geneva. However, Mansory claims that the blue exterior with gold paint job ‘accentuates Ghost’s bold lines.’ Well, bold it is, but with utter bad taste. Moving on to its functionality, we can’t complain, as Mansory replaced the 6.6-liter V12’s twin turbochargers with bigger units, which produces a massive 720hp and 752-pound feet of torque. With a sprint of zero to 62mph in 4.4 seconds (4 seconds faster than the original Ghost) and a weight of 5450 lbs, this sedan should be one hell of a ride. The interiors are upholstered with leather hides, smooth ultra suede, exquisitely patterned carbon fiber, and bamboo trim on request. The Sun has quoted the price of this wild ride as £200,000 (US$303,000).
